如何去除CSS4浮動?
在CSS4中,浮動是一種常用的布局方式,但有時候我們需要去除它,如何去除CSS4浮動呢?
1、使用clear屬性
CSS4中的clear屬性可以用來清除浮動,我們可以將clear屬性設(shè)置為both、left或right,以清除左右兩側(cè)的浮動,如果我們想要清除右側(cè)的浮動,可以使用以下代碼:
.div1 { float: right; } .div2 { clear: right; }
在上面的代碼中,div1會向右浮動,而div2會清除右側(cè)的浮動。
2、使用margin屬性
我們可以使用margin屬性來消除浮動的影響,如果我們想要消除一個浮動元素下方的內(nèi)容與其之間的空間,可以使用以下代碼:
.div1 { float: left; margin-bottom: -10px; /* 消除下方空間 */ }
在上面的代碼中,div1會向左浮動,并且其下方的內(nèi)容與其之間的空間會被消除。
3、使用position屬性
我們還可以使用position屬性來消除浮動,如果我們想要將一個浮動元素固定在頁面的某個位置,可以使用以下代碼:
.div1 { float: left; position: fixed; /* 固定位置 */ }
在上面的代碼中,div1會向左浮動,并且其位置會被固定在頁面的某個位置。
去除CSS4浮動有多種方法,我們可以根據(jù)具體的需求選擇適合的方法。